Recovery After Ectopic Pregnancy: Physical and Emotional Healing



Understanding Recovery After an Ectopic Pregnancy

An ectopic pregnancy can be a physically and emotionally challenging experience. It occurs when a fertilized egg implants outside the uterus, most commonly in the fallopian tube. After treatment, recovery involves not only healing from the medical procedure but also coping with the emotional impact of pregnancy loss. Understanding what to expect can help women navigate this difficult period with confidence and support.
 
Physical Healing and Post-Treatment Care

Physical recovery depends on the type of treatment received. Some women may recover after medication, while others may require surgery. It is common to experience mild pain, fatigue, and light bleeding for a few weeks. Adequate rest, proper hydration, and following medical advice are essential for a smooth recovery.

Patients should attend follow-up appointments to ensure hormone levels return to normal and that healing is progressing as expected. Managing Emotional Well-Being

The emotional effects of an ectopic pregnancy can be significant. Feelings of sadness, grief, anxiety, or even guilt are common and completely understandable. Every woman processes loss differently, and there is no right or wrong way to grieve.

Talking with family members, friends, or professional counselors can provide valuable emotional support. Joining support groups may also help women connect with others who have experienced similar challenges. Giving yourself time to heal emotionally is just as important as physical recovery.
 
Planning for Future Pregnancies

Many women who experience an ectopic pregnancy can go on to have healthy pregnancies in the future. However, it is important to discuss future family planning with a healthcare provider. A thorough evaluation can help identify any underlying factors that may have contributed to the ectopic pregnancy.
